In the realm of artificial intelligence, designing effective model architectures is a crucial task. Varied architectural patterns have emerged, each with its own advantages. Engineers are continually exploring new architectures to enhance model performance for a spectrum of applications. From simple feedforward networks to complex recurrent and convolutional networks, the domain of model architectures is continuously evolving.
A Taxonomy of Machine Learning Models
A compelling taxonomy of machine learning models helps us organize these algorithms based on their design. We can distinguish various categories such as supervised learning, each with its own distinct set of techniques. Within these main categories, there are numerous sub-categories, reflecting the complexity of machine learning.
- Grasping these categories is crucial for choosing the most effective model for a specific task.
- Moreover, it enables exploration and the creation of new and innovative machine learning models.
Exploring Transformer Architectures
Transformer models have revolutionized the field of natural language processing, achieving state-of-the-art results in a variety of tasks. These powerful architectures leverage attention mechanisms to capture long-range dependencies within text, enabling them to understand complex relationships between copyright. Unlike traditional recurrent neural networks, transformers can analyze entire sequences of data in parallel, leading to significant gains in training speed and efficiency. By delving into the inner workings of transformer models, we can gain a deeper understanding into their capabilities and unlock their full potential for data generation, translation, summarization, and beyond.
Selecting the Right Model for Your Project
Embarking on a machine Model Types learning journey often involves a critical decision: selecting the appropriate model for your specific task. This selection can significantly impact the performance and accuracy of your outcomes. A variety of models, each with its own capabilities, are available, ranging from linear regression to deep neural networks. It's essential to meticulously consider the nature of your data, the complexity of the problem, and your desired targets when making this significant selection.
- , Start by grasping the type of problem you're trying to tackle. Are you dealing with classification, regression, or clustering?
- Then analyze the characteristics of your data. Is it structured, unstructured, or semi-structured? How much data do you have available?
- Finally, consider your resources. Some models are more computationally intensive than others.
Grasping Generative and Discriminative Models
In the realm of machine learning, creative and differentiating models represent two fundamental approaches to tackling complex problems. Generative models aim to generate new data instances that resemble the training dataset, effectively learning the underlying distribution. In contrast, discriminative models focus on understanding the demarcations between different classes of data. Think of it this way: a generative model is like an artist who can mimic paintings in a similar style to their inspiration, while a discriminative model acts more like a judge who can sort artworks based on their characteristics.
- Implementations of generative models include generating pictures, while discriminative models are widely used in duties such as identifying spam and medical diagnosis.
AI's Shifting Landscape of Models
Throughout the development of artificial intelligence, the types of models employed have undergone a significant evolution. Early AI systems relied on deterministic approaches, but the advent of machine learning altered the field. Today, we see a expansive range of model types, including neural networks, each with its own advantages. From image identification to natural language generation, these models continue to expand the boundaries of what's achievable in AI.